Ctg road accidents kill 5, including couple

NTV Online
01 September, 2017, 18:47
Update: 01 September, 2017, 18:47

Five people, including a couple, were killed in three separate road accidents in Satkania upazila and in Chittagong on Friday morning.

In Satkania, a passenger bus of ‘Challenger Paribahan’ overturned in Nayakhaler Mukh area after the driver lost control over the steering at 10:00am, leaving Gias Uddin, 28, a resident of Satkania municipality, and his wife Nur Nahar Akter Nuri, 23, dead on the spot and nine passengers injured, reports the UNB.

The injured were taken to local hospital while one of them Azizul Islam, 55, a resident of Banglabazar area in the upazila, succumbed to his injures on the way, said officer-in-charge of Dohazari Highway Police Station Mizanur Rahman.

Earlier in the day, two young men — M Sohel, 32, son of Nurul Absar, hailing from Purba Rahadabad area in Fatikchhari upazila, and M Bashir, son of Abu Taher of Bhola sadar upazila, were killed in two separate road accidents at Aturar Dipu and Hamjarbagh areas respectively in the city.

Both the bodies were taken to Chittagong Medical College Hospital morgue, said sub-inspector Jahirul Islam, in-charge of hospital police camp.
